1. Composition

Profhilo is a type of bio-remodelling treatment that contains high concentrations of hyaluronic acid (HA). HA is a naturally occurring substance in our skin that helps in maintaining hydration and promoting collagen production. On the other hand, dermal fillers are typically made of synthetic substances such as hyaluronic acid or calcium hydroxylapatite, which provide volume and structure to the skin.

2. Application

Profhilo is injected into multiple points across the face, neck, or hands using a fine needle. This technique helps to spread the product evenly and stimulate collagen production. Dermal fillers, on the other hand, are injected into specific areas of the face to enhance volume or fill in wrinkles and lines.

3. Longevity

The effects of Profhilo can last up to six months due to its unique hybrid nature. It combines both high molecular weight and low molecular weight HA, resulting in a sustained release of hyaluronic acid over time. Dermal fillers, depending on the type and brand used, can last anywhere from six months to two years.

4. Skin Rejuvenation

Profhilo is primarily designed for skin rejuvenation and overall improvement in skin quality. It stimulates collagen and elastin production, resulting in improved skin texture, hydration, and firmness. Dermal fillers, in addition to rejuvenation, are commonly used to restore volume loss, enhance facial contours, and reduce the appearance of lines and wrinkles.

5. Side Effects

Both Profhilo and dermal fillers are generally safe treatments with minimal side effects. Common side effects include mild swelling, bruising, and redness at the injection site, which typically resolve within a few days. It is important to consult with a qualified professional to ensure proper administration and reduce the risk of complications.

6. Price

The average price of Profhilo treatment ranges from $600 to $1000 per session, depending on the location and provider. Dermal fillers, on the other hand, can vary widely in cost depending on the type of filler used and the amount required. Prices typically range from $400 to $1500 per syringe.

8. Conclusion and FAQs

In conclusion, both Profhilo and dermal fillers offer effective results for skin rejuvenation. The choice between the two depends on individual goals, concerns, and the recommendation of a qualified medical professional. Here are some commonly asked questions:

Q1: Which treatment is better for volumizing the cheeks?
A1: Dermal fillers are often preferred for adding volume to the cheeks.

Q2: Can Profhilo be used in combination with dermal fillers?
A2: Yes, some practitioners combine Profhilo with dermal fillers to achieve comprehensive results.

Q3: Are these treatments painful?
A3: Discomfort during the treatments can vary from person to person, but topical anesthetics or numbing cream can be used to minimize any pain or discomfort.

Q4: How soon can I see results?
A4: Results from both Profhilo and dermal fillers can usually be seen within a few weeks, with further improvement over time.

Q5: Are these treatments permanent?
A5: No, both Profhilo and dermal fillers provide temporary results, and additional treatments are required to maintain the effects.
